Значок Excel с восклицательным знаком: расшифровка и устранение ошибок

Каждый, кто регулярно работает с электронными таблицами, рано или поздно сталкивался с ситуацией, когда привычный зеленый логотип программы внезапно меняет свой вид. Вместо стандартного изображения на иконке файла или внутри ячейки появляется желтый треугольник или красный круг с белым восклицательным знаком внутри. Это визуальный сигнал, игнорировать который профессионалу нельзя, так как он указывает на нарушение целостности данных или критический сбой в логике вычислений.

Появление индикатора ошибки может быть вызвано множеством факторов, начиная от банльной опечатки в формуле и заканчивая повреждением структуры самого файла. Система автоматически сканирует содержимое ячеек и, обнаруживая несоответствие ожидаемому типу данных или синтаксису, помечает проблемные зоны. Понимание природы этого знака — первый шаг к восстановлению работоспособности документа.

В большинстве случаев пользователь видит этот символ в двух основных контекстах: как атрибут ярлыка файла в проводнике операционной системы или как маркер в левом верхнем углу ячейки внутри интерфейса программы. Microsoft Excel использует единую систему логирования ошибок, однако визуальное отображение может варьироваться в зависимости от версии программного обеспечения и настроек безопасности. Далее мы детально разберем все возможные сценарии.

⚠️ Внимание: Если значок с восклицательным знаком появился на ярлыке файла в папке Windows, это часто свидетельствует о том, что файл был создан или отредактирован в более новой версии программы, чем та, которая установлена у вас, либо файл помечен системой как потенциально небезопасный.

Не стоит паниковать при виде тревожных символов. В 90% случаев проблема решается простой проверкой синтаксиса формул или изменением параметров доверия к источнику данных. Главное — правильно идентифицировать тип предупреждения, чтобы не потерять важную информацию при попытке «лечения» документа.

Интерпретация символов в ячейках таблицы

Когда вы открываете документ и видите маленький треугольник или значок в углу ячейки, программа сообщает о локальной проблеме с содержимым. Чаще всего это ошибка вычисления, которая препятствует получению корректного результата. Система предлагает несколько вариантов решения, доступных через контекстное меню, которое открывается при нажатии на значок.

Наиболее распространенной причиной является деление на ноль или ссылка на несуществующую ячейку. В таких случаях программа отображает кодовые значения, такие как #ДЕЛ/0! или #ССЫЛКА!. Восклицательный знак в этом контексте служит индикатором того, что автоматический пересчет невозможен без вмешательства пользователя. Игнорирование этих предупреждений может привести к cascading errors, когда одна ошибка распространяается по всему листу.

Иногда значок появляется не из-за ошибки в формуле, а из-за несоответствия формата данных. Например, если в ячейке, отформатированной как дата, вы вводите текст, или если число записано с использованием разделителей, не принятых в текущих региональных настройках. Excel помечает такие ячейки, предполагая, что пользователь мог допустить опечатку.

  • 🔍 Проверка формулы: Нажмите на значок, чтобы увидеть подробное описание ошибки и варианты её исправления, предложенные алгоритмом программы.
  • 📉 Анализ зависимостей: Используйте инструмент трассировки, чтобы понять, какие именно ячейки влияют на проблемное значение и где кроется разрыв логической цепочки.
  • 🛡️ Игнорирование: Если вы уверены в правильности своих действий, можно выбрать опцию игнорирования, чтобы убрать визуальный маркер, но это не исправит underlying issue.

Важно различать предупреждения о возможных ошибках и критические сбои. Первые часто носят рекомендательный характер (например, «число, записанное как текст»), вторые же блокируют выполнение вычислений. Для глубокого анализа проблемных зон удобно использовать встроенную панель поиска и выборки ошибок, которая позволяет пройтись по всем помеченным ячейкам sequentially.

⚠️ Внимание: Будьте осторожны с опцией «Игнорировать ошибку». Если вы примените её к ячейке с некорректной ссылкой, а затем скопируете формулу в другие места, ошибка может тиражироваться, что приведет к неверным итоговым расчетам в отчетах.

Значок на ярлыке файла в проводнике Windows

Отдельного внимания заслуживает ситуация, когда восклицательный знак появляется не внутри программы, а на иконке файла в операционной системе. Это явление часто сбивает с толку пользователей, так как сам файл может открываться без видимых проблем. Однако этот символ указывает на атрибуты файла или проблемы совместимости, которые важно учитывать.

Чаще всего такой значок означает, что файл был создан в более новой версии офисного пакета, чем та, которая установлена на вашем компьютере. Система предупреждает о потенциальной потере функциональности или форматирования при открытии. Также это может быть маркером того, что файл был загружен из интернета и помечен системой безопасности как происходящий из другого компьютера.

В некоторых случаях значок появляется, если файл находится в состоянии синхронизации с облачным хранилищем и возник конфликт версий. OneDrive или SharePoint могут помечать такие документы, требуя разрешения конфликта перед продолжением работы. Игнорирование этого статуса может привести к тому, что ваши изменения не сохранятся или будут перезаписаны более старой версией.

Чтобы устранить этот индикатор, часто достаточно просто открыть файл и сохранить его заново в актуальном формате, либо изменить свойства файла в окне «Свойства» (вкладка «Общие»), сняв галочку «Разблокировать», если она там присутствует. Это действие подтверждает, что вы доверяете источнику файла.

📊 Где вы чаще всего встречаете значок ошибки?
Внутри ячейки Excel
На ярлыке файла в папке
В всплывающем окне при сохранении
Я не знаю, о чем речь

Основные типы ошибок и коды

Для эффективного устранения проблем необходимо знать «язык», на котором программа сообщает о сбоях. Каждая ошибка имеет свой уникальный код, который начинается с решеточки. Понимание расшифровки этих кодов позволяет быстро диагностировать проблему, не прибегая к методу тыка.

Одной из самых частых ошибок является #ЗНАЧ!, которая возникает, когда формула содержит аргументы неправильного типа. Например, попытка математических операций с текстовыми строками, которые не могут быть преобразованы в числа. Также распространена ошибка #ИМЯ?, указывающая на то, что программа не распознает текст в формуле — часто это результат опечатки в имени функции или отсутствии кавычек вокруг текстовых значений.

Более сложные случаи связаны с циклическими ссылками, когда формула ссылается сама на себя, создавая бесконечный цикл вычислений. В этом случае программа может вообще отказаться пересчитывать лист или выдаст предупреждение о циклической зависимости. Восклицательный знак здесь сигнализирует о критическом нарушении логики таблицы.

Код ошибки Описание проблемы Вероятная причина
#ДЕЛ/0! Деление на ноль В знаменателе формулы стоит 0 или пустая ячейка
#Н/Д Значение недоступно Функция поиска не нашла искомое значение
#ССЫЛКА! Неверная ссылка Удалена ячейка, на которую ссылалась формула
#ЧИСЛО! Некорректное число Аргумент функции выходит за допустимые пределы

Существует также ошибка #ИМЯ?, которая часто возникает при использовании функций, определенных пользователем, если надстройка, содержащая эти функции, не подключена. В корпоративной среде это может быть связано с отсутствием доступа к общим макросам или библиотекам VBA.

⚠️ Внимание: Ошибка #Н/Д (N/A) часто используется специально в формулах поиска, чтобы обозначить отсутствие данных. Не спешите «лечить» ячейки с этим кодом, если они являются результатом корректной работы функции ВПР или ПОИСКПОЗ.

Скрытые ошибки в массивах

Если вы работаете с динамическими массивами, ошибка в одной ячейке исходного диапазона может привести к появлению значков ошибки во всем результирующем массиве. Проверяйте исходные данные в первую очередь.

Настройки проверки ошибок и игнорирование правил

Программа позволяет гибко настраивать правила, по которым определяются потенциальные ошибки. Возможно, значок с восклицательным знаком появляется там, где его быть не должно, согласно вашей логике работы. В таком случае необходимо обратиться к настройкам проверки ошибок.

Для доступа к этим параметрам следует перейти в меню Файл → Параметры → Формулы. В разделе «Проверка ошибок» вы увидите список правил, которые активны по умолчанию. Здесь можно отключить проверку чисел, записанных как текст, или игнорирование ячеек, содержащих только формулы. Однако делать это следует с осторожностью.

Отключение определенных правил проверки может ускорить работу с большими массивами данных, где тысячи ложных предупреждений мешают обзору. Но стоит помнить, что вы берете на себя ответственность за контроль целостности данных. Автоматическая проверка — это страховка, которая часто спасает от дорогостоящих ошибок в отчетах.

☑️ Настройка проверки ошибок

Выполнено: 0 / 5

Если вы решили игнорировать ошибку для конкретной ячейки, но сохранить правило активным для остальной таблицы, используйте контекстное меню значка. Выберите пункт «Пропустить ошибку». Это действие добавит исключение для данной ячейки, и зеленый треугольник исчезнет, хотя логическая проблема (если она есть) останется.

Проблемы с макросами и безопасностью

Восклицательный знак может сигнализировать о проблемах, связанных с исполняемым кодом. Если файл содержит макросы, а уровень безопасности установлен на высокий, программа блокирует их выполнение и предупреждает об этом пользователя. В этом случае значок служит индикатором того, что функционал документа ограничен.

Часто такая ситуация возникает при скачивании файлов из внешних источников. Система безопасности помечает файл как потенциально опасный. Чтобы устранить предупреждение и разрешить выполнение макросов, необходимо добавить путь к файлу в список надежных узлов или снизить уровень безопасности, что не всегда рекомендуется.

Также значок может появляться, если макрос содержит синтаксическую ошибку или пытается обратиться к несуществующему объекту. В этом случае при запуске макроса или пересчете таблицы, зависящей от него, появится сообщение об ошибке времени выполнения. Visual Basic Editor поможет найти строку кода, вызывающую сбой.

  • 🔐 Центр управления безопасностью: Проверьте настройки макросов в разделе «Центр управления безопасностью», чтобы понять, почему блокируется контент.
  • 📂 Надежные расположения: Добавьте папку с рабочими файлами в список надежных расположений, чтобы избежать постоянных предупреждений.
  • 📉 Отладка кода: Если ошибка в макросе, используйте пошаговое выполнение (F8) для поиска проблемной строки.

В корпоративных сетях политики безопасности могут быть заданы администратором централизованно. В таком случае пользователь не сможет самостоятельно изменить настройки, и значок будет появляться до тех пор, пока файл не будет сертифицирован IT-отделом.

Восстановление поврежденных файлов

Если значок с восклицательным знаком появляется на ярлыке файла, но сам файл не открывается или открывается с искажениями, велика вероятность повреждения структуры файла. Формат XLSX представляет собой архив XML-файлов, и повреждение даже одного из внутренних компонентов может привести к появлению предупреждений.

Для решения проблемы попробуйте использовать встроенную функцию восстановления. При попытке открытия файла нажмите на стрелку рядом с кнопкой «Открыть» и выберите «Открыть и восстановить». Программа попытается исправить ошибки файловой структуры. Этот метод помогает в большинстве случаев незначительных повреждений.

Если стандартное восстановление не помогает, можно попробовать открыть файл в безопасном режиме или на другом компьютере. Иногда проблема кроется не в самом файле, а в конфликте надстроек или драйверов печати на конкретном рабочем месте. Также стоит проверить файл антивирусом, так как некоторые угрозы маскируются под документы.

В крайнем случае, можно попробовать изменить расширение файла на .zip, открыть его как архив и проверить целостность внутренних XML-структур. Однако этот метод требует продвинутых знаний и должен использоваться только опытным пользователем, так как есть риск окончательно повредить данные.

Как быстро убрать все значки ошибок на листе?

Выделите весь лист (Ctrl+A), перейдите в меню «Главная» → «Найти и выделить» → «Выделить группу ячеек». Выберите «Ошибки» и нажмите ОК. Все ячейки с ошибками будут выделены. Теперь вы можете очистить их содержимое или заменить формулой обработки ошибок, например, обернув исходную формулу в функцию ЕСЛИОШИБКА.

Почему значок появляется только после сохранения?

Это может означать, что при сохранении произошло изменение формата файла или сжатие данных, которое выявило несовместимость некоторых элементов. Также возможно, что при сохранении активировался макрос, который внес изменения, вызвавшие ошибку проверки.

Может ли значок означать вирус?

Сам по себе значок не является признаком вируса, но файлы из непроверенных источников, несущие макровирусы, часто помечаются системой безопасности. Всегда проверяйте файлы с расширенным функционалом антивирусом перед запуском макросов.